A fire erupted overnight in Pico Rivera leaving a local Shakey’s restaurant in need of repair Thursday morning.

The blaze was reported around 2 a.m. in the area of Whittier Boulevard and Durfee Avenue, a spokesperson with the Los Angeles County Fire Department told KTLA.

Firefighters arrived to find smoke and fire coming from the roof of the single-story building.

It took firefighters about 30 minutes to extinguish the blaze, which was contained to the southeast side of the restaurant, the spokesperson said.

No further details were given on the extent of the damage.

Investigators had not yet determined the cause of the fire.

No injuries were reported.
